Market Reaction to Tariff Pause
The recent announcement from President Trump regarding a 90-day pause on higher tariffs has sparked a substantial rally in the stock market, with the S&P 500 gaining nearly 10%. This news, particularly impactful for cyclical stocks like airlines, has revived investor confidence after a turbulent trading stretch. Delta Airlines reported adjusted earnings per share (EPS) of $0.46, exceeding expectations, and although revenue met expectations, the company refrained from offering updated guidance due to the uncertainties surrounding tariffs and reduced bookings. The strong EPS can positively influence investor sentiment towards Delta, highlighting its resilience amidst broader economic concerns.

Economic Indicators and Earnings Sentiment
The lifting of tariffs for most countries, while maintaining a significant tariff rate on China, indicates ongoing trade negotiations that may stabilize market expectations in the short term. Despite today’s rally, concerns about the overall economy persist, particularly as consumer and corporate confidence appears to have deteriorated. The remarks from Delta’s CEO underscore an urgency to monitor demand trends as companies navigate through the fallout from the tariff situation.

The stock prices for Delta, JetBlue, and United Airlines have risen significantly, attributed in part to Delta’s strong earnings report. Such price movements are common in correlated sectors where a positive earnings beat by one major player can buoy others in the industry. Although it’s encouraging that Goldman Sachs has rescinded its recession call for the U.S. economy following the tariff announcement, skepticism remains regarding sustained growth amidst tariff negotiations and market volatility. Investors may want to proceed cautiously as the economic outlook remains uncertain, despite positive earnings from Delta.
